Lynx Split with #14 Marietta College

The Rhodes College baseball team split today's double header with #14 Marietta College.  Rhodes lost the first game 3-0, before defeating the Pioneers 4-3 in 10 innings in the second game.  Junior Chris Conkell drove in the winning run in the bottom of the 10th on a sacrifice fly to right field scoring junior Kyle Peterson.  Sophomore Austin Carden picked up the loss for the Lynx in the first game and freshman John White got his first collegiate victory in the second game.  Rhodes is now 9-3 on the year.

Carden went 6 innings in the first game allowing 4 hits, 2 runs, both of which were earned, walked 1 and struck out 6.  Carden is now 2-2 on the year.  Freshman Jackson Baker worked the seventh inning, allowing 1 hit, 1 unearned run, and struck out 1.  Junior 1B Brogan Jayne was 1-3 and senior 2B Andy Boucher was 1-2.

In the second game of the day, junior Taylor Babich worked the first five innings allowing 9 hits, 3 earned runs, walked 1, and struck out 2.  Junior Hunter Chandler relieved Babich in the sixth and allowed 1 hit, 1 walk, and struck out 2 over the next 3 innings.  Freshman John White threw the 9th and 10th and did not allow a runner to reach base.  In doing so, White collected his first collegiate victory and is now 1-0 on the year.

The Lynx offense was led by junior 1B Brogan Jayne who was 2-5 on the day.  Junior RF Matt Gilbert was 2-4 with a run scored.  Senior 2B Andy Boucher was 1-1 with a double.  Freshman SS Lynden Pindling was 2-2 on the day.  Junior C Chris Conkell was 0-2, but drove in the winning run on a sacrifice fly to right field in the bottom of the 10th.

Rhodes will return to action tomorrow afternoon at 1:00 against Blackburn College.

Andrew Galow
Men's Basketball
Currently leading the Lynx in scoring for the 2011-2012 season, Galow averages 15.3 points per game and has helped the team to their current record of 12-6.  Andrew also boasts some impressive stats; currently leading the team in scoring, assists, steals, and defensive rebounds.  Earning conference recognition, Galow was named the SCAC Player of the Week for 11/28-5/5.   
Sharwil Bell
Women's Basketball
As the co-captain of the 2011-2012 squad, Sharwil has continued to dominate on the hard-court for the Lady Lynx.  On December 29th, she became the 13th player in school history to surpass the 1,000 point mark, averaging 16.6 points per game throughout her career.  Her accolades for this season include d3hoops.com preseason All-American, SCAC Player of the Week (12/19- 1/2), and SCAC Character and Community Athlete of the Week (12/25-1/1).
